Ambiq Semiconductor's Cutting-Edge Microcontrollers: Revolutionizing Low Power Design

In the ever-evolving landscape of embedded systems, resource efficiency is paramount. Ambiq's cutting-edge microcontrollers have emerged as a leading solution for designers seeking to optimize their applications. Built on advanced low-power technologies, these microcontrollers deliver exceptional performance while minimizing consumption.

One of the key features of Ambiq's microcontrollers is their groundbreaking architecture. The company's proprietary subthreshold power-saving technology allows devices to operate at incredibly low levels, significantly extending battery life. This makes them ideal for a diverse range of applications, including wearables, sensors devices, and industrial controls.

Moreover, Ambiq's microcontrollers boast impressive processing performance. They offer multiple processing units and a high-speed memory interface, enabling them to handle demanding tasks with ease. This combination of low power consumption and high performance makes Ambiq's microcontrollers the perfect choice for designers who need to balance both factors in their products.
